But then I realized that King Baelor and his ill-fated great-nephew, Prince Baelor, are linked to the dragon of Aegon I : Balerion. We see other characters who seem to echo the name Bael, from the "King Beyond the Wall" legend - Baelish, Abel. ![]() I couldn't figure out why the human name Baelor had been used only once for a Targ king and once for another member of the royal family. I think the key, in some cases, may be to look at overlap between names of monarchs and names of dragons.
